North Las Vegas police ask public's assist to find lacking 19-year-old with autism

- Advertisement -

LAS VEGAS (KLAS) — North Las Vegas police are asking for the general public’s assist to find a lacking 19-year-old who’s identified with autism.

In line with police, Laryia Reagor was final seen on July 31 at round 5 a.m. close to her residence within the space of Martin Luther King Boulevard and June Avenue.

Laryia Reagor, 19, was final seen on July 31 at round 5 a.m. close to her residence within the space of Martin Luther King Boulevard and June Avenue. (NLVPD)

Reagor has been identified with autism and capabilities on the stage of a 9 to 12-year-old youngster, police mentioned. She requires medicine and supervision from members of the family.

She is roughly 5 toes 3 inches tall and weighs round 160 kilos. She has lengthy brown hair styled in braids and brown eyes. Police mentioned she was final seen sporting a long-sleeve grey shirt with an image of Tupac Shakur on it and tan pants.

Anybody with info on the whereabouts of Reagor is requested to contact the North Las Vegas Police Division instantly at 702-633-9111.
